Expressing support for the designation of September 2024 as "National Polycystic Kidney Disease Awareness Month", and raising awareness and understanding of polycystic kidney disease.
Impact
The recognition of National Polycystic Kidney Disease Awareness Month serves to amplify awareness and understanding of PKD's effects beyond the immediate health ramifications, extending to financial and emotional stressors faced by individuals and their caregivers. By fostering broader public awareness, the resolution aims to encourage more individuals to seek regular healthcare, potentially leading to earlier diagnosis and management of PKD symptoms, thereby reducing complications such as kidney failure, which afflicts nearly half of those diagnosed by age 60.
Summary
HR1505 is a resolution proposing the designation of September 2024 as 'National Polycystic Kidney Disease Awareness Month'. This initiative aims to enhance public awareness and understanding of polycystic kidney disease (PKD), a prevalent genetic disorder affecting approximately 500,000 individuals in the United States. The resolution not only acknowledges the impacts of PKD on patients and families but also highlights the necessity for further research into treatment options and cures for this serious health condition.
Contention
While the bill has general support due to its focus on raising awareness for a condition that is often overlooked, some criticism may arise regarding the effectiveness of awareness months in making tangible changes. Critics might argue that while awareness is beneficial, it should be accompanied by concrete policy changes or funding initiatives to support research and treatment accessibility for those affected by PKD. The alignment of public health awareness with actionable public health strategies will be a topic of discussion among stakeholders.
